WebSingle table inheritance is a way to emulate object-oriented inheritance in a relational database. When mapping from a database table to an object in an object-oriented … WebDec 18, 2024 · The relational modeler is faced with a problem. how to design the tables so as to emulate the benefits that one would get from inheritance? The simplest technique is called single table inheritance. Data about all types of cars are grouped into a single table for cars. There is a column, car_type, that groups together all the cars of a single type.
